Can you get gel nails on super-short fingernails?

My fingernails are an embarrassment. They are so short and ugly. When I say short, I mean SHORT. They peel and crack and it's pointless for me to try to grow them out. I want pretty nails so badly, so I've been thinking about getting gels put on, but I don't know if they can be put on my pathetic stubs. I don't want t waste the money if they are going to just fall off. And I don't want the embarrassment of going to a nail salon and inquiring about such nails if I'm just going to be told to run along.Can you get gel nails on super-short fingernails?
You can get extensions put on your short nails that will grow out. They'll stay put after the gel hardens.





But I have to warn you that if and when you decide to stop having gel nails done, your natural nails will look awful for months afterward. I had them for a couple of months last year, and while they did look very nice, what I saw after I took them off did not make me happy. Not only had more than one nail broken down past the quick, what was left of my nails was severely damaged and had ridges in them. As they grew out they broke very easily and cracked. And to top it all off, as the gel sets under the UV lights it HURTS. Badly. I'll never have them done again.
